US Stocks: Wednesday's unofficial close

27 Jul, 2006

US stocks were little changed on Wednesday as stronger-than-expected quarterly results by General Motors Corp. and gains in energy companies offset a drag fuelled by a drop in plane maker and US defence contractor Boeing Co.'s shares.
Stocks cut their early losses around noon. After registering some slight gains, the three major indexes dipped back into negative territory in early afternoon trading.
The Dow Jones industrial average was down 1.28 points, or 0.01 percent, at 11,102.43. The Standard & Poor's 500 Index was down 0.59 of a point, or 0.05 percent, at 1,268.29. The Nasdaq Composite Index was down 5.51 points, or 0.27 percent, at 2,068.39.
